I guessed the plot twist in the first quarter of the book, but then I reminded myself this is a book for young adult readers. It was really annoying for me, as a social worker, to have the protagonist and the authors note at the end embellish the fact that the victims were daughters, mothers, sisters, etc because I think their personhood isn’t contingent upon relation to others but that’s a me problem. I can appreciate a female protagonist who is tough and feminine but the author doesn’t seem to understand the show don’t tell concept. Audrey Rose said it several times throughout the book. Took me a long time to get through because it moved slowly and got boring but I could understand why people liked it. Just not for me and I don’t think I’ll read more of the series.

I read this with my book club, and I’m glad that I did. I enjoyed the witty banter between Audrey Rose and Thomas, with me wanting to simultaneously whack Thomas and giggling at the things he said! I also enjoyed that our main character went against societal norms, but did not reject all things considered ‘proper’. We were presented with a well-rounded and realistic character that was easy to connect with. I felt all of the pain and anger that she experienced at the world that was just trying to make a housewife out of her.

I did, however, see the twist coming, and while the book was still well written, I was hoping to be surprised by a devastating turn of events. 

I’ve always been interested in Jack the Ripper and the hold he had over London so this book was definitely interesting, and I loved the inclusion of images at the beginning of different chapters. Overall, this was a great pick for my book club, and I can see myself reading the next book in the series, though it is not at the top of my list.
